Progressive Delivery across clouds and service meshes using Weave Flagger with Service Mesh Hub and SuperGloo

May 15, 2019

Weave Flagger is now integrated with SuperGloo. That means, you can download Weave Flagger from Solo.io’s Service Mesh Hub, a mesh extension catalogue and instantly have progressive delivery capabilities with the service mesh of your choice.

We are excited that Solo.io’s team is announcing its Service Mesh Hub built on top of SuperGloo, the service mesh orchestrator. We are doubly excited because Weave Flagger is part of the Mesh Extensions Catalog. This gives users progressive delivery capabilities with the service mesh of their choice!

What does this mean for users?

The Service Mesh Hub simplifies the experience for users needing to install, manage, and operate their service meshes. The new Service Mesh Hub Extensions Catalog lets end users extend their environment with a mesh aware recommendation engine and extensions installer.

Weave Flagger is a Kubernetes operator that automates the promotion of canary deployments using Istio, App Mesh or NGINX routing for traffic shifting and Prometheus metrics for canary analysis.

weave_flagger.png

With Weave Flagger users can add progressive delivery capabilities (canary, A/B, Blue/Green, etc.) to any service mesh managed by the Service Mesh Hub. Users can follow the current instructions to integrate SuperGloo and Weave Flagger, or starting today they can select Weave Flagger from the Service Mesh Hub.
